Application of act to resident of foreign country and foreign support proceeding

In plain English

Missouri courts use specific sections of state law when dealing with child or spousal support cases that involve another country. This applies when there is a support order from another country, a court from another country is involved, or one of the people in the case lives in another country. Special rules also apply for cases that fall under an international agreement called the Convention, and those special rules take priority if there is a conflict.
